Bio
Mai Khoi is a Vietnamese singer and musician who composes across folk,
blues, dance and rock genres.
Mai Khoi won Vietnam Television Song and Album of the Year Award in
2010 and has since toured the US and Australia. The 31-year-old recently
married Australian lyricist Benito del Sur and moved to Sydney to start a
multi-racial band by the name of Fish Sauce.
Mai Khoi’s angelic voice and emotional intimacy is ideal for acoustic solo
gigs while her provocative and playful flare puts the ants back in the pants
on sexually charged dancefloors.
Mai Khoi hit the headlines last year when her controversial single Selfie
Orgasm was removed from Zing MP3 after receiving close to 300,000 views
in the first week. There were even calls for the video and song to be
banned from her homeland – communist Vietnam – for the obscene lyrics
and first-ever depiction of a naked woman in a music video.
“She’s got that 80’s Madonna swagger, self-secure woman, I know
who I am vibe,” says Grammy Award recognised producer Mark
Tarsia, who mastered her Saigon Boom Boom album.
Mai Khoi is no stranger to controversy and as a Vietnamese celebrity
is somewhat of an anomaly for having spoken out about LGBT rights,
violence against women, and traditional gender stereotypes. From a
country that has made virtually no musical inroads outside of its own
culture, Mai Khoi is charting a highly independent path.
Mai Khoi may well be the first internationally recognised Vietnamese-born
singer and songwriter.
